The Dryer as a Metaphor for Transformation
At first glance, a dryer is relegated to the domestic sphere. However, in the context of a dream, it assumes a more nuanced significance as a metaphorical apparatus for transformation. The dryer is the mechanism through which damp, heavy garments emerge revitalized, warm, and ready for use. This mirrors the evolution of the human spirit through life’s trials and tribulations.
Dreaming of a dryer may herald a period of transition. It serves as an invitation to shed past burdens, dry away the “dampness” of sorrow or regret, and embrace personal growth. This process represents the shift from a state of vulnerability or stagnation to one of readiness and renewal.

Symbolism and Emotional Cleansing
In dream analysis, objects often symbolize internal emotions or abstract concepts. The dryer specifically symbolizes emotional cleansing. Just as clothes are processed to emerge fresh and clean, individuals may dream of this appliance when grappling with feelings of guilt, regret, or sorrow.
Dreaming of a dryer is often an optimistic sign—a subconscious proclamation that healing is possible and that the dreamer is ready to purge themselves of emotional burdens.
Spiritual and Cultural Perspectives
The spiritual interpretations of the dryer vary across different cultural and religious paradigms, often linking the appliance to themes of purity.
Christian Interpretations
In Christianity, water is a primary symbol of baptism, denoting purification and rebirth. Because the dryer follows the washing process, it can resonate with themes of redemption. It suggests a call to seek forgiveness and spiritual renewal. Furthermore, as garments in biblical texts often align with notions of righteousness, a dryer may symbolize the pursuit of moral integrity and divine favor.
Islamic Interpretations
In Islamic tradition, dreams are often viewed as a window into the soul. A dryer may signify the cleansing of one’s heart and intentions. The concept of taharah (purity) is central to Islamic faith, emphasizing both physical and spiritual cleanliness. Dreaming of a dryer may imply a yearning for a pure heart, urging the dreamer to reflect on their moral compass and seek atonement for past transgressions.

Analyzing Dream Variations
| Dream Scenario | Potential Meaning |
|---|---|
| Using a dryer normally | Successful processing of emotions and healing. |
| An overloaded dryer | Feeling overwhelmed by reality or emotional baggage. |
| A broken dryer | Stagnation or inability to move past a traumatic event. |
| Clothes spinning rapidly | A feeling of being caught in a cycle of stress or anxiety. |
